Powersoft Organised Seminars in Mexico and Guatemala

With training sessions organised in Latin countries, Powersoft carried out seminars and showed its products with the help of local distributors.

Powersoft’s Luca Gianni, System Engineering Manager, Gilberto Morejón, CALA Sales Manager, and Fabrizio Bolzoni, Sales Account Manager for Rack Amplifiers, recently supported local markets by hosting training seminars for Latin professionals in Mexico and Guatemala.

Celebrating the 15th anniversary of Mexican Sound.check Expo, Powersoft presented for the first time in Latin America the new Quattrocanali Series on Audio Acústica and Electrónica’s local Powersoft distributor booth. The new series includes three models (1204, 2404 and 4804), respectively boasting 300, 600 and 1200 watts per channel at 8 ohms.

K Series and M Series amplifiers were also showcased on the booth.

On the two last days of the trade show, Powersoft and Audio Acústica carried out two intensive morning seminars in the Main Room nightclub (Colonia Roma, Mexico City), where a very attendees could find out more on the technology used in Powersoft amplifiers and make the best of the Armonía Pro Audio Suite control software, which will be benefit from a new 2.10 version by the end of May.

“The trade show is very well-known in the area and appeared to be very focused on live sound, with many brands showing new technologies”, said Luca Gianni about his first participation to the trade show. “The quantity of visitors on our booth over three days was pretty impressive”

Gilberto Morejón explained: “I think Sound.check Expo was successful in terms of attendance and because of the interest in our brand. We noticed people were already aware of our distributor in Mexico and we welcomed regular Powersoft users who were interested in updating their equipment or had special technical requirements”

Education in Guatemala

Guatemala was next on the agenda for Powersoft, who organized a two days event with the help of distributor Supersonidos. The Powersoft Audio Technology and Amplifiers Seminar was split over two days: The first one focused on professional training on the X Series coupled with the Armonía software and its new features. The second day was a general seminar for a younger audience eager to learn.

“We had a great experience in Guatemala!”, added Luca. “On the first day, we met an audience of free-lancers and rental company owners who were keen to benefit from advanced training. They also provi-ded us with great feedback, in particular on the new Armonía Interactive Tuning feature (integration with Smaart)

Gilberto agreed: “The experience in Guatemala was really positive, with many technicians interested in Armonía and an excellent organization by Supersonidos supervised directly by general manager Guillermo Falla. The second day was broadcasted on Facebook Live and is available on Supersonidos profile”

Talking about Powersoft’s initiative to promote teaching and learning on new technologies, Fabrizio Bolzoni commented: “I strongly believe that education is the key to success for any brand in our industry. That’s the reason why Powersoft has invested, and will continue to invest, in these activities all over the world. The Central American users have responded in a very proactive way and distributors have been able to attract quality customers with a surprising skill level, increasing the quality of the sessions”

Powersoft’s conference and seminar tour with Luca Gianni and Gilberto Morejón will travel to more Latin American cities in September, with sessions already planned in Argentina, Chile, Uruguay, Paraguay and Brazil.
